I have heard that Us citizen can go to Argentina 90 days at a time without a visa I assume this is still true?

More importantly my wife and step son aren't US citizens they are Philippine citizens. So I am wondering if something similar is available for them or would we need to go to the Argentine Embassy to get Visas for them. Anyone know what the rules are for Filipinos?

I believe a 90-day visa is for just about every Foreigner and when the 90 days are up you can go to Santiago, Chile or Monte Video, Uruguay, via Buenos Aires, for a day or two and return to receive another 90-day Visa.
